What Is Real-Time Warehouse Monitoring?
Real-time warehouse monitoring refers to the continuous tracking and reporting of various warehouse parameters such as inventory movements, environmental conditions, equipment functionality, and personnel activity through advanced sensors, cameras, and software platforms. Unlike traditional batch or manual data entry methods, this approach provides instantaneous insights into operations as they happen.
By integrating sensors, RFID tags, video surveillance, and IoT devices, warehouse managers gain a comprehensive overview of their facilities. This helps reduce errors, prevent theft, and streamline workflows.
Key Benefits of Real-Time Warehouse Monitoring
The adoption of real-time warehouse monitoring delivers numerous advantages that directly impact profitability and operational excellence:
Enhanced Inventory Accuracy
Manual stock counts can be time-consuming and prone to errors. Real-time monitoring automates inventory tracking, updating stock levels instantly when goods are received, moved, or shipped. This minimizes discrepancies and ensures orders are fulfilled correctly.

Increased Operational Efficiency
Real-time data enables warehouse managers to identify bottlenecks, optimize routes for forklifts, and balance workloads dynamically. This prevents delays and ensures faster turnaround times for orders.
Improved Equipment Utilization
Monitoring equipment health and usage in real-time helps prevent unexpected breakdowns and costly repairs. Alerts can notify maintenance teams about issues before they escalate, reducing downtime.
Enhanced Security and Safety
Integrating real-time video surveillance and environmental sensors enhances security by detecting unauthorized access or hazardous conditions like temperature fluctuations or smoke.
Technologies Behind Real-Time Warehouse Monitoring
Several cutting-edge technologies come together to create effective real-time monitoring systems:
Internet of Things (IoT) Sensors
IoT sensors collect data such as temperature, humidity, motion, and equipment status throughout the warehouse. These sensors continuously transmit information to centralized platforms.
RFID and Barcode Scanning
RFID tags and barcode scanners facilitate instant identification and tracking of inventory items. RFID is especially useful for automatic detection without manual scanning.
Video Surveillance and AI Analytics
Modern camera systems paired with AI-driven analytics allow real-time monitoring of warehouse activities. This technology can detect unusual behavior, track employee movements, and verify compliance with safety protocols.
Cloud-Based Monitoring Platforms
Cloud computing enables real-time data aggregation, storage, and access from any device. Managers can monitor warehouse operations remotely and generate actionable reports.
How to Implement Real-Time Warehouse Monitoring
Implementing a real-time warehouse monitoring system requires careful planning and execution:
1. Assess Your Current Operations
Evaluate your warehouse’s existing processes, technology, and pain points. Identify the key metrics you want to monitor, such as inventory accuracy, equipment uptime, or environmental conditions.
2. Choose the Right Technologies
Select sensors, cameras, and software platforms that fit your warehouse size, budget, and operational complexity. Consider scalability for future expansion.
3. Integrate with Existing Systems
Ensure the new monitoring system can seamlessly connect with your Warehouse Management System (WMS), Enterprise Resource Planning (ERP), or other software to centralize data.
4. Train Staff
Provide comprehensive training to warehouse staff and management on using the new technology and interpreting data for improved decision-making.
5. Monitor and Optimize
Continuously analyze the data generated to identify improvement areas. Use insights to fine-tune workflows, maintenance schedules, and security protocols.
Real-Time Monitoring Use Cases in Warehouses
Understanding real-world applications can help visualize the value of real-time monitoring:
Inventory Control
With instant stock updates, managers avoid stockouts or overstocking. Automated alerts can trigger replenishment orders or flag inventory discrepancies immediately.
Equipment Maintenance
Monitoring forklifts, conveyor belts, and other machinery in real-time allows predictive maintenance, saving time and money on repairs.
Safety and Compliance
Detecting unsafe employee behavior or hazardous environmental conditions helps enforce safety standards and reduce workplace accidents.
Loss Prevention
Real-time video analytics can spot theft or damage events as they occur, enabling swift intervention.
Challenges and Considerations
While the benefits are clear, implementing real-time warehouse monitoring is not without challenges:
- Initial Investment: Upfront costs for sensors, cameras, and software can be significant.
- Data Management: Handling large volumes of real-time data requires robust IT infrastructure and cybersecurity measures.
- Integration Complexity: Merging new systems with legacy software may require specialized expertise.
- User Adoption: Ensuring all staff adopt the technology and workflows takes effort and ongoing support.
However, with the right strategy and partners, these challenges can be successfully managed to reap long-term benefits.
Future Trends in Warehouse Monitoring
The field of warehouse monitoring continues to evolve rapidly, driven by advances in AI, robotics, and data analytics:
- AI-Powered Predictive Analytics: Enhanced algorithms will provide more accurate forecasts and automated decision-making.
- Autonomous Vehicles and Drones: Automated inventory checks and material handling will further streamline operations.
- Edge Computing: Processing data closer to the source will reduce latency and improve responsiveness.
- Augmented Reality (AR): AR glasses and devices will assist workers with real-time instructions and inventory data.
Staying abreast of these trends ensures your warehouse remains competitive and efficient.
